Output 334c67fbe2343062c136df65fc8f52e66da978ddc93124116077c8ee2617429e:0

value
40076858
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7b86da97e926aac89a5aa7c93a677fe56012924 OP_EQUALVERIFY OP_CHECKSIG
address
1Papqh1HTRitp9CcSXYG8RAgMugHr4NGED
transaction
334c67fbe2343062c136df65fc8f52e66da978ddc93124116077c8ee2617429e
spent
true